Production AI Playbook: Deterministic Steps & AI Steps (5 of 5)
Workflow name
Production AI Playbook: Deterministic Steps & AI Steps (5 of 5)

The full end-to-end workflow that chains all patterns together. This template processes customer feedback from intake to team routing, with normalization, validation, native guardrails, AI classification, and confidence-based branching at every step.

What you'll do

  • Send customer feedback through a webhook and watch it flow through every stage.
  • See the data get normalized, validated, and scanned by n8n's native Guardrails node for jailbreak attempts and PII.
  • Watch the AI classify feedback (bug report, feature request, praise, complaint, question) with a confidence score and generate a personalized response draft.
  • See AI-generated responses pass through output guardrails that check for NSFW content and secret keys before reaching users.
  • Watch high-confidence results route automatically: bug reports and feature requests to the product team, complaints to customer success, and praise to marketing as testimonial candidates.

What you'll learn

  • How to chain normalization, validation, native guardrails, AI, and routing into a single pipeline
  • How to use n8n's Guardrails node for both input screening (jailbreak, PII, secret keys) and output screening (NSFW, secret keys)
  • How confidence-based branching separates high-confidence results from items that need human review
  • How Switch nodes route classified feedback to the right destination (product team, customer success, or marketing)
  • How every step between AI nodes is deterministic and inspectable
  • How all these patterns work together in a production-ready workflow

Why it matters This is the complete picture. Individual patterns are useful on their own, but the real power comes from combining them into a pipeline where AI handles the judgment calls and everything else follows explicit, testable rules.
